Brian J. Neary Sworn In as Trustee of the Hudson County Bar Association  

Brian J. Neary has been named as an officer of the Hudson County Bar Association.  Mr. Neary, along with officers and other trustees, was sworn in by the Honorable Maurice Gallipoli, Hudson County assignment judge at the Association's annual dinner held at the Liberty House, Jersey City in January 2007.  He is presently the Association's Membership Secretary.  Brian is in the line of succesion to be the Hudson County Bar President.

The Hudson County Bar Association, one of the State's oldest bar associations, includes many members who are regarded as leaders statewide in their respective specialties.  Brian's experience and reputation as a criminal defense lawyer continues that leadership tradition.

Brian has a career long commitment to bar associations.  He is the former president of the statewide Association of Criminal Defense Lawyers of New Jersey, as well as a trustee and officer of ACDL-NJ (his swearing in ceremony and dinner in 1997 also took place in Jersey City, at the historic Jersey Central Railroad station - less than 200 yards from the Liberty House).

Mr. Neary is a life member of several bar associations dedicated to criminal defense, including ACDL-NJ, the New York State Association of Criminal Defense Lawyers and the National Association of Criminal Defense Lawyers.  He is also a twenty-five year member of the Bergen County Bar Association.
